Subject: Insurance renewal — quick heads-up

Hi team,

Just flagging for branch managers that our policy with Quillbrook Underwriting renews next month. Good news: we've held the premium increase to 5%, despite the warehouse incident in Fenlow. Less good: the new terms require updated fire inspections at every branch before renewal date, so please get those booked soon. I'll circulate the checklist this week. How this fits our broader plans is covered in the confidential note below.

management briefing: Silethax Systems plans to raise the Holix list price by 50.2 percent in December. The steering committee signed off on a budget of $329.9 million for Project Holok. The renewal with Juldorax Foods closes at $278.2 million a year, 54.3 percent above the last contract. Project Briir slips by one quarter because of the supplier delay.

A: Duplicates usually mean the consumer took longer than 10 seconds to acknowledge, so the dispatcher retried. This is expected behaviour; consumers must deduplicate on the event sequence number. Duplicates are not a data-integrity problem and do not require paging the carrier-integrations team unless the duplicate rate exceeds 8% sustained over an hour. Check the dispatcher latency panel first, then the consumer ack times. The dedupe guidance and latency dashboards are linked from the page below.

runbook for badug-kadup: https://confluence.zemvarlabs.internal/projects/browse/display/projects/bd1b

## Releases

Hey support folks — quick notes on ProfileMesh shard releases. Each release re-balances user-profile shards gradually, so don't panic if a lookup lands on a stale shard for a few minutes post-deploy; it self-heals. Release bundles are published twice a month and are always signed. If a customer asks you to verify a bundle they downloaded, walk them through the checksum step using the public signing key below.

deploy key for kawif-bageg: bky19_YQNdHDgpaLxUNwPoHm9